About this book

Shy, imaginative May Bird is still stranded in the Ever After, a spooky-yet-whimsical realm filled with ghosts, odd creatures, and starry reaches between worlds. With her hairless cat Somber Kitty and a ragtag group of spectral friends, she must brave eerie landscapes and clever villains to find a way home. The story blends chills, humor, and heart, making it a great pick for readers who enjoy fantastical quests with a gothic twist. Perfect for middle graders who like brave underdogs, quirky worldbuilding, and fast-paced adventure.

Setting: the Ever After (an eerie afterlife realm) and small-town West Virginia; a quest across shadowy lands and starry voids

What grade level is May Bird Among the Stars?

May Bird Among the Stars has an AR reading level of 5.8, which places it at a 5th grade reading difficulty. The interest level is rated Middle Grades (4–8) — this reflects the age-appropriateness of the content and themes, not just the reading difficulty. A strong younger reader may handle the words fine while the themes are aimed at an older audience, or vice versa.
